How Tall Were The Mayans?
The Maya Indians were so short that some scholars called them the pygmies of Central America: the men averaged only five feet two, the women four feet eight.
How tall was the average ancient Mayan?
The average height of the men is 5 feet 1 inch and of the women, 4 feet 8 inches.” While not so stated in Morley’s book, we as children were led to believe that the Maya were a naturally short race of people.

What killed most of the Mayans?
“The main finding was that a prolonged drought contributed to the collapse of Classic Mayan civilization,” environmental archaeologist Douglas Kennett told LiveScience two years ago. Droxler and his colleagues published their findings in Scientific Reports.
How many Mayans are left 2020?
Today, more than seven million Maya live in their original homelands of Mesoamerica and in countries all over the world.
How tall was the average Aztec?
A: We don’t have information from Aztec Ruins, but based on nearby excavations it appears most women were about 4′ 8”, and most men were 5′ 2.” Interestingly however, the height of people found at great houses similar to Aztec Ruins was about 2″ taller on average, suggesting they had better access to nutritious high- …

Did the Mayans invent chocolate?
The Mayans invented chocolate insofar as they were the first civilization to make a beverage from the beans of the cacao tree.

What did the Maya call themselves?
It gets complicated, but the people we now call ‘Maya‘ actually called themselves by the name of their home town or city. We call them ‘Maya’ because linguists now know that all the languages of the Maya area are connected to a common root that existed sometime around 1,500 B.C. But the ancient Maya didn’t know that!

Where did the Mayans come from originally?
The Maya are probably the best-known of the classical civilizations of Mesoamerica. Originating in the Yucatán around 2600 B.C., they rose to prominence around A.D. 250 in present-day southern Mexico, Guatemala, northern Belize and western Honduras.

What race is Mayan?
The Maya peoples (/ˈmaɪə/) are an ethnolinguistic group of indigenous peoples of Mesoamerica. The ancient Maya civilization was formed by members of this group, and today’s Maya are generally descended from people who lived within that historical civilization.
